Role Description: Bookkeeper
The Bookkeeper reports to the Treasurer.
The bookkeeper is primarily responsible for recording and maintaining financial transactions.
Accountabilities:
Maintain an accurate record of financial transactions, including
Update and maintain the general ledger
Track and reconcile bank statements
Maintaining financial records
Document filing and storage – invoices, receipts, bank statements etc.
Prepare financial reports
Assist with financial planning (forecast, budget, long-range plan)
Assist with the preparation of financial statements
Support tax filing and audits
Assist with cost analysis and financial modelling
Skills
Strong attention to detail and level of accuracy
Strong organizational skills
Proficiency in spreadsheet (Microsoft Excel) and accounting software
General knowledge of accounting principles
Effective verbal and written communication skills
Experience
Experience as a bookkeeper or financial assistant is considered an asset.
The bookkeeper will be directed and supported by the Treasurer and members of the Finance Sub-Committee. The time commitment is approximately 5 to 15 hours per month with occasional periods of high demand (ex. year end). Most responsibilities can be executed remotely.
